Mugliya Gaon

Mugliya Gaon is a village located in Yamkeshwar tehsil of Garhwal district in Uttarakhand, India. It is situated 25km away from sub-district headquarter Yamkeshwar (tehsildar office) and 165km away from district headquarter Pauri. As per 2009 stats, Venuk is the gram panchayat of Mugliya Gaon village.

About Mugliya Gaon

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Mugliya Gaon is 048621. The village spans a total geographical area of 119.61 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 246121. Rishikesh is nearest town to Mugliya Gaon village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 43km away.

Population of Mugliya Gaon

Below is a concise population overview of Mugliya Gaon as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 218 117 101
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 20 12 8
Scheduled Castes (SC) 20 11 9
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 18 8 10
Literate Population 193 105 88
Illiterate Population 25 12 13

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Mugliya Gaon village:

  • The total population of Mugliya Gaon village is around 218, including approximately 117 males and 101 females, with a sex ratio of 863 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 20 children aged 0–6 years in Mugliya Gaon village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Mugliya Gaon village has 20 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 18 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Mugliya Gaon village is about 88.53%, with male literacy at 89.74% and female literacy at 87.13%.
  • There are around 43 households in Mugliya Gaon village.

Connectivity of Mugliya Gaon

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Mugliya Gaon. As per the 2011 stats, Mugliya Gaon had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
